image/jpeg: reduce bound checks from idct and fdct
Before - $gotip build -gcflags="-d=ssa/check_bce/debug=1" fdct.go idct.go ./fdct.go:89:10: Found IsInBounds ./fdct.go:90:10: Found IsInBounds ./fdct.go:91:10: Found IsInBounds ./fdct.go:92:10: Found IsInBounds ./fdct.go:93:10: Found IsInBounds ./fdct.go:94:10: Found IsInBounds ./fdct.go:95:10: Found IsInBounds ./fdct.go:96:10: Found IsInBounds ./idct.go:77:9: Found IsInBounds ./idct.go:77:27: Found IsInBounds ./idct.go:77:45: Found IsInBounds ./idct.go:78:7: Found IsInBounds ./idct.go:78:25: Found IsInBounds ./idct.go:78:43: Found IsInBounds ./idct.go:78:61: Found IsInBounds ./idct.go:79:13: Found IsInBounds ./idct.go:92:13: Found IsInBounds ./idct.go:93:12: Found IsInBounds ./idct.go:94:12: Found IsInBounds ./idct.go:95:12: Found IsInBounds ./idct.go:97:12: Found IsInBounds ./idct.go:98:12: Found IsInBounds ./idct.go:99:12: Found IsInBounds After - $gotip build -gcflags="-d=ssa/check_bce/debug=1" fdct.go idct.go ./fdct.go:90:9: Found IsSliceInBounds ./idct.go:76:11: Found IsSliceInBounds ./idct.go:145:11: Found IsSliceInBounds name old time/op new time/op delta FDCT-4 1.85µs ± 2% 1.74µs ± 1% -5.95% (p=0.000 n=10+10) IDCT-4 1.94µs ± 2% 1.89µs ± 1% -2.67% (p=0.000 n=10+9) DecodeBaseline-4 1.45ms ± 2% 1.46ms ± 1% ~ (p=0.156 n=9+10) DecodeProgressive-4 2.21ms ± 1% 2.21ms ± 1% ~ (p=0.796 n=10+10) EncodeRGBA-4 24.9ms ± 1% 25.0ms ± 1% ~ (p=0.075 n=10+10) EncodeYCbCr-4 26.1ms ± 1% 26.2ms ± 1% ~ (p=0.573 n=8+10) name old speed new speed delta DecodeBaseline-4 42.5MB/s ± 2% 42.4MB/s ± 1% ~ (p=0.162 n=9+10) DecodeProgressive-4 27.9MB/s ± 1% 27.9MB/s ± 1% ~ (p=0.796 n=10+10) EncodeRGBA-4 49.4MB/s ± 1% 49.1MB/s ± 1% ~ (p=0.066 n=10+10) EncodeYCbCr-4 35.3MB/s ± 1% 35.2MB/s ± 1% ~ (p=0.586 n=8+10) name old alloc/op new alloc/op delta DecodeBaseline-4 63.0kB ± 0% 63.0kB ± 0% ~ (all equal) DecodeProgressive-4 260kB ± 0% 260kB ± 0% ~ (all equal) EncodeRGBA-4 4.40kB ± 0% 4.40kB ± 0% ~ (all equal) EncodeYCbCr-4 4.40kB ± 0% 4.40kB ± 0% ~ (all equal) name old allocs/op new allocs/op delta DecodeBaseline-4 5.00 ± 0% 5.00 ± 0% ~ (all equal) DecodeProgressive-4 13.0 ± 0% 13.0 ± 0% ~ (all equal) EncodeRGBA-4 4.00 ± 0% 4.00 ± 0% ~ (all equal) EncodeYCbCr-4 4.00 ± 0% 4.00 ± 0% ~ (all equal) Updates #24499 Change-Id: I6828d077b851817503a7c1a08235763f81bdadf9 Reviewed-on: https://go-review.googlesource.com/c/go/+/167417 Run-TryBot: Agniva De Sarker <agniva.quicksilver@gmail.com> TryBot-Result: Gobot Gobot <gobot@golang.org> Reviewed-by: Nigel Tao <nigeltao@golang.org>
